Message type: E = Error
Message class: GG - Messages for FI-SL customizing
Message number: 050
Message text: You do not have authorization to change global companies
You do not have authorization to change global company data.
The system switches to the display mode.
If you want to change global company data, you must obtain the necessary
authorization for object 'G_880_GRMP'.

- You do not have authorization to change global companies ?The SAP error message GG050, which states "You do not have authorization to change global companies," typically occurs when a user attempts to modify settings related to global companies in the SAP system but lacks the necessary authorization.
Cause:
The error is primarily caused by insufficient authorization in the user's role or profile. In SAP, access to certain functions, including the ability to change global company settings, is controlled by authorization objects. If the user does not have the appropriate permissions assigned, they will encounter this error when trying to perform the action.
Solution:
To resolve the GG050 error, follow these steps:
Check User Authorizations:
- Verify the user's current roles and authorizations. This can be done by using transaction code
SU53
immediately after the error occurs. This transaction will show the last authorization check and help identify which specific authorization is missing.Review Authorization Objects:
